Two-Factor Authentication Issue And Fix
Some members are currently having issues with Two-Factor Authentication that sends them in a loop of being prompted to authorize over and over again. The issue is related to users with ipv6 addresses. The fix is to change your IP from IPv6 to IPv4 in windows. Please do the follow:
